Tiny flying robots have always faced a brutal trade-off between agility and battery life, burning through power just to stay ...
Robots flying around in space seem more like fiction than reality, but recently NASA has been testing their free-flying robots called Smart SPHERES (Synchronized Position Hold, Engage, Reorient, ...